Roof Turbine Repair in Alpharetta, GA
Roof turbine repair services focus on maintaining and restoring the function of roof ventilators, which are vital components that help regulate airflow and temperature within a home. These turbines are typically installed on sloped roofs and operate by spinning with the wind to exhaust hot air and moisture from the attic space. Projects involving roof turbine repair may include fixing or replacing damaged blades, addressing mechanical issues with the spinning mechanism, or ensuring proper sealing to prevent leaks. Property owners often request this service when experiencing signs of poor ventilation, such as excessive heat buildup, increased energy costs, or visible damage to the turbines themselves.
Before requesting roof turbine repair, homeowners should consider the age and condition of the existing units, as well as any recent weather events that could have caused damage. It’s helpful to understand whether the turbines are functioning properly, making unusual noises, or showing signs of rust or wear. Clarifying the scope of the repair needed-whether it involves simple adjustments or complete replacement-can ensure the project addresses the root of the issue. Proper maintenance and timely repairs can extend the lifespan of roof turbines and help maintain a balanced, well-ventilated attic environment.

Common Roof Turbine Repair Jobs
Roof turbine repair involves fixing or replacing damaged or malfunctioning ventilation turbines to ensure proper attic airflow.
Roof turbine replacement restores the function of worn or broken turbines to prevent moisture buildup and roof damage.
Wind damage repair addresses turbines affected by storms or high winds to maintain roof ventilation efficiency.
Corrosion and rust repair involves treating or replacing turbines affected by weather-related deterioration.
Vibration and noise issues are resolved through turbine adjustments or repairs to reduce roof noise and vibrations.
Routine inspection services identify potential turbine problems early to prevent costly repairs and ensure proper ventilation.
Roof Turbine Repair Questions
What are roof turbines used for? Roof turbines help ventilate attics by releasing hot air, improving airflow and reducing moisture buildup.
How can I tell if a roof turbine needs repair? Signs include unusual noises, wobbling, or visible damage such as rust or cracks on the turbine.
Is it necessary to repair or replace roof turbines? Repair or replacement depends on the extent of damage and effectiveness; a professional assessment can determine the best option.
What are common issues that affect roof turbines? Common problems include corrosion, loose fittings, damaged blades, and debris blocking airflow.
